Kerrang magazine - 30 Seconds To Mars cover (16 February 2008 - Issue 1197)
- £12.99
Kerrang magazine - 30 Seconds To Mars cover (16 February 2008 - Issue 1197)
SHOP > Music Magazines > KERRANG Magazine Back Issues
SHOP > Music Magazines > KERRANG Magazine Back Issues